A product designer focuses on creating functional and attractive products. They handle various stages of product development, from concept to final design. Their work involves understanding user needs, developing prototypes, and refining designs based on feedback and usability testing. Key responsibilities are:
In essence, a product designer bridges user needs, business objectives, and technical possibilities.

The cost of hiring a designer can vary based on factors such as project complexity, the candidate's expertise, and location. Experienced designers with specialized skills tend to charge higher rates. Additionally, the geographical location can influence the cost, as designers from countries with lower living costs may offer more competitive rates.

Once you’ve picked the designers you’re interested in learning more about, you can start by reviewing their portfolio, looking for projects similar to yours, and evaluating the overall quality of their work. Check for a diverse range of skills, such as proficiency in relevant design tools, understanding of user experience principles, and adaptability to different design styles.
During the interview, ask specific questions about their design approach, problem-solving skills, and ability to meet project deadlines. Additionally, consider requesting references or testimonials from previous clients to gain insights into the designer's professionalism and work ethic.
